### Quick Entry runners (S29–S37, future QE-*)
|
||
|
||
Quick Entry tests inject the OS-level shortcut via `ydotool` /
|
||
`/dev/uinput`. One-time setup per host or VM:
|
||
|
||
```sh
|
||
# Install the binary + daemon
|
||
sudo dnf install -y ydotool # or: sudo apt install ydotool
|
||
|
||
# Make ydotoold's socket world-writable so the test runner reaches it
|
||
sudo mkdir -p /etc/systemd/system/ydotool.service.d
|
||
sudo tee /etc/systemd/system/ydotool.service.d/override.conf <<'EOF'
|
||
[Service]
|
||
ExecStart=
|
||
ExecStart=/usr/bin/ydotoold --socket-perm=0666
|
||
EOF
|
||
sudo systemctl daemon-reload
|
||
sudo systemctl enable --now ydotool.service
|
||
```
|
||
|
||
After this, `ydotool key 29:1 29:0` (Ctrl tap) should exit 0. The
|
||
runner sets `YDOTOOL_SOCKET=/tmp/.ydotool_socket` automatically;
|
||
override the env var if your daemon binds elsewhere.
|
||
|
||
ydotool **cannot** drive portal-grabbed shortcuts (kernel uinput
|
||
events vs compositor portal grabs) — those tests stay manual until
|
||
libei adoption broadens. See [`docs/testing/automation.md`](../../docs/testing/automation.md#input-injection--ydotool-now-libei-next).

### Per-test isolation default
|
||
|
||
`launchClaude()` creates a fresh `XDG_CONFIG_HOME` / `CLAUDE_CONFIG_DIR`
|
||
under `$TMPDIR/claude-test-*` for every launch and removes it on
|
||
`close()`. This is the default to prevent state leaks between tests
|
||
(SingletonLock collisions, persisted Quick Entry positions, etc. —
|
||
see Decision 1 in [`docs/testing/automation.md`](../../docs/testing/automation.md)).
|
||
Three escape hatches:
|
||
|
||
- **`launchClaude()`** — default, fresh per-launch isolation.
|
||
- **`launchClaude({ isolation })`** — pass a shared `Isolation` handle
|
||
to launch the same app twice with persistent state (e.g. S35
|
||
position-memory across restart).
|
||
- **`launchClaude({ isolation: null })`** — opt out entirely; share
|
||
the host's `~/.config/Claude`. Used by tests gated on
|
||
`CLAUDE_TEST_USE_HOST_CONFIG` for signed-in claude.ai access.

## How L1 testing works (the SIGUSR1 path)
|
||
|
||
The shipped Electron has a CDP auth gate that exits the app whenever
|
||
`--remote-debugging-port` or `--remote-debugging-pipe` is on argv and a
|
||
valid `CLAUDE_CDP_AUTH` token isn't in env. Both Playwright's
|
||
`_electron.launch()` and `chromium.connectOverCDP()` inject the gated
|
||
flag, so both are blocked.
|
||
|
||
The gate doesn't check `--inspect` or runtime `SIGUSR1`, which is the
|
||
same code path as the in-app `Developer → Enable Main Process Debugger`
|
||
menu item. So:
|
||
|
||
1. `launchClaude()` spawns Electron with no debug-port flags (gate
|
||
asleep) and waits for the X11 window.
|
||
2. `app.attachInspector()` sends `SIGUSR1` to the pid; Node's inspector
|
||
opens on port 9229.
|
||
3. `lib/inspector.ts` connects via WebSocket and exposes
|
||
`evalInMain(body)` and `evalInRenderer(urlFilter, js)` for tests.
|
||
|
||
From the inspector you can:
|
||
- Drive the renderer via `webContents.executeJavaScript()`
|
||
- Install main-process mocks (e.g. `dialog.showOpenDialog` for T17)
|
||
- Inspect any Electron API state
|
||
|
||
Two gotchas worth knowing:
|
||
|
||
- `BrowserWindow.getAllWindows()` returns 0 because frame-fix-wrapper
|
||
substitutes the BrowserWindow class. Use `webContents.getAllWebContents()`
|
||
instead — works correctly and includes both the shell window and the
|
||
embedded claude.ai BrowserView.
|
||
- `Runtime.evaluate` with `awaitPromise: true` returns empty objects for
|
||
awaited Promise resolutions. `inspector.evalInMain<T>()` returns
|
||
`JSON.stringify(value)` from the IIFE and parses on the caller side
|
||
to dodge this.

### Hooking Electron — read this before reaching for `BrowserWindow`
|
||
|
||
`scripts/frame-fix-wrapper.js` returns the `electron` module wrapped
|
||
in a `Proxy` whose `get` trap returns a closure-captured
|
||
`PatchedBrowserWindow`. **Constructor-level wraps don't work** — your
|
||
`electron.BrowserWindow = WrappedCtor` write lands on the underlying
|
||
module but the Proxy keeps returning `PatchedBrowserWindow` on
|
||
read, so the wrap is bypassed. The reliable hook is at the
|
||
**prototype-method level**:
|
||
|
||
```ts
|
||
// in inspector.evalInMain(...)
|
||
const proto = electron.BrowserWindow.prototype;
|
||
const orig = proto.loadFile;
|
||
proto.loadFile = function(filePath, ...rest) {
|
||
// record `this` + filePath; identify popups by filePath suffix
|
||
return orig.call(this, filePath, ...rest);
|
||
};
|
||
```
|
||
|
||
This captures every instance regardless of subclass identity.
|
||
Construction-time options (`transparent: true`, `frame: false`,
|
||
etc.) aren't observable through this hook — use runtime
|
||
equivalents instead (`getBackgroundColor()`, `getContentBounds()
|
||
vs getBounds()`, `isAlwaysOnTop()`). `lib/quickentry.ts` is the
|
||
worked example.
